- The distance between Lisbon, Nd, Usa and Hilo, (Big Island), Hawaii, Hawaii is approximately 5,921 km or 3,680 mi.
- To reach Lisbon, Nd in this distance one would set out from Hilo, (Big Island), Hawaii bearing 46.7°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Lisbon, Nd bearing 80.4° or E .
- Lisbon, Nd has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Hilo, (Big Island), Hawaii has a tropical rainforest climate (Af).
- Lisbon, Nd is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Hilo, (Big Island), Hawaii is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 18.5 °C (33.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 33.2 °C (59.8°F) more in Lisbon, Nd.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 2790.4 mm (109.9 in) less which is equivalent to 2790.4 l/m² (68.48 US gal/ft²) or 27,904,000 l/ha (2,983,123 US gal/ac) less. About 1/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 25.3° lower in Lisbon, Nd than in Hilo, (Big Island), Hawaii.
